Transaction e2a691085891351ea36bfb05c21b080fdd6ac350f3a89f62ec16da5182e26a69
1 Input
1 Output
-
e2a691085891351ea36bfb05c21b080fdd6ac350f3a89f62ec16da5182e26a69:0
- value
- 24986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 339e908e316d299b429e790ce92ce941fac3037d OP_EQUAL
- address
- 36PxLbNnsAjBkAh5ZipCrwPqEkRU9KPm7h